Karaikal (/ˈkɑːraɪkʌl/, Tamil: [kaːɾɐi̯kːaːl], French: Karikal /kaʁikal/) is a port city of the Indian Union Territory of Puducherry. It is the administrative headquarters of the Karaikal District and the second most populated town in the Union Territory after Pondicherry. Located on the Coromandel Coast of Bay of Bengal in South India, it is situated at the center of a coastal enclave surrounded by the state of Tamil Nadu and its Cauvery delta districts (Mayiladuthurai, Tiruvarur and Nagapattinam).
